This Year's Model Updates:

For the old 1.8T GTI, the VR6 style has been dropped and more features, including 17-inch wheels and stability control, are now standard. Starting in the late spring of 2006, the 1.8T Volkswagen GTI will be slowly phased out in favor of a fully redesigned model. As before, this performance hatchback will be based on the upcoming next-generation Golf. Highlights for the new GTI include increased performance, new styling and more interior room.

Pros:
  • Hatchback utility, upscale features and interior design, strong engine and automated manual gearbox of redesigned GTI.
Cons:
  • Higher price than those of its competitors, old GTI lacks oomph.

  • Not Again - 2006 Volkswagen GTI
    By -

    I received a new GTI for graduation. On my first trip to college with less than 3,000 miles, 6 weeks old, the compressor cracked and backed off the engine shredding the belt. This car stranded me 120 miles from home. My parents brought car back to VW to be fixed. The fix lasted five days. My parents attempted to drive up to my college and the compressor shut down again, this time 590 miles from home. My parents brought it back to VW again, now they are saying two weeks at minimum. This car only has 2000 miles on it. The Honda Civic Si is looking really good right now.

  • 2006 VW GTI Nightmare - 2006 Volkswagen GTI
    By -

    I purchased a 2006 GTI in June. My vehicle is has less than 3,000 miles on it. I gave it to my son for doing well in high school and earning a college scholarship. On his first trip to school from Clearwater, FL to Florence, SC the A/C compressor cracked in half, backed off the enginge and shreded the belt. He made it as far as Orlando. The parts are back ordered three weeks. The mechanic at VW informed me that he has three Passats waiting for the same part. It appears to be a recall candidate, yet VW America denies any issues. I purchased this vehicle for piece of mind as my sons campus is about 500 miles away and it breaks down on first trip to school. VWs customer service has been terrible. Beware, 2006 GTI may be fun to drive, but it has problems.

  • Well, I Wanted to like this Car... - 2006 Volkswagen GTI
    By -

    I bought my GTI in June, and I have had nothing but issues with it. The airbag light keeps coming on, which the dealer fixed twice. With the sunroof open, and the windows up, it sounds like a machine gun is being fired in the car...the wind noise is so loud, it is useless to even drive this way. The torque is nice to have down low, but on the highway, I have nothing left in the top end. I wish it had a little more REAL power up top. Also, the car makes a strange metal tapping/rattling noise up front somewhere, and the center dash rattles. All and all, this is what I have come to expect from VW, which is bells, whistles and a whole lot of buyers remorse.
